Swiping back in an iframe causes few seconds pause on Safari iOS 12 Beta 3
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=195184
Summary Swiping back in an iframe causes few seconds pause on Safari iOS 12 Beta 3
Arthur
Reported 2019-02-28 13:24:17 PST
Something similar to https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=193860 or https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=193215 but only main page case embedded <iframe> and that iframe uses history navigation. So swiping back freezes the page for a few seconds. Tapping back button is Safari works fine and the page is accessible immediately.
